pondering a vehicle purchase, it's crucial to understand
your options. There are more
considerations than merely
brand-new or utilized; going down the
used-vehicle path will likewise
require an option between purchasing from a personal seller or
a dealer. Even among
pre-owned cars at
the dealer lot, there's a subset
marketed as "certified
secondhand," or CPO, which are
typically sold through
certified new-car dealers.
Because they
generally include
a better service warranty,
fairly modest miles, and a thorough
inspection, CPO
cars strike a
possibly engaging happy medium
between brand-new and used. <BR>
Here are 5 reasons a certified pre-owned (CPO)
car may be right
for you: <BR> 1. It's Cheaper Than Buying New <BR>
Let's get the most
obvious factor out of the way. New
vehicles and trucks are, by
nature, more pricey than their utilized
brethren. On average, two-year-old CPO
lorries are
normally 25 percent more affordable, and those four years old tend to be 40 percent less
pricey.
It
is important to remember that
CPO automobiles do bring a premium
over their non-CPO utilized equivalents.
The question purchasers require to ask
themselves is: Do the extra
advantages of buying a
CPO justify the greater rate?
<BR> 2. There's a Manufacturer-Backed Guarantee <BR> Which gets us into another
reason that a CPO makes sense for certain buyers.
Since with that premium,
car manufacturers provide a
range of manufacturer-backed warranties. Much like the
cars and trucks and trucks they
assist accredit, not all
warranties are
developed equivalent,
nevertheless, so buyers will desire
to pay unique attention to the
warranty specifics. There are
powertrain-limited service warranties and
bumper-to-bumper guarantees, and
a number of car manufacturers
offer mixes of both. <BR> Powertrain
warranties
typically cover longer
durations, such as 6 years or 100,000 miles from
the date the vehicle was
bought brand-new. A bumper-to-bumper
warranty may last for one
year or cover 12,000 miles and might consist of
a deductible of $50 to $100. When looking
for a CPO, buyers ought
to make certain to
ask about the length of the
warranty, the information
regarding types of
repair work that need paying a deductible, and
the list of items not covered at all. Pay attention to whether the
producer has a cost to
move a CPO guarantee
should you want to sell
the cars and truck or truck before the service warranty ends.
(BMW, for example, charges $200 for the
guarantee to be transferred to
a subsequent owner.). <BR> 3. The Car
Has Actually Been Examined. <BR> Among the factors a service
warranty is provided in the very first
place is due to the fact that
makers ensure
CPO automobiles, trucks, and SUVs
are in solid working order before
they provide them up for sale. Unlike an as-is
secondhand automobile that you'll discover on a dealership lot
or listed by a private seller, CPO
vehicles are executed a
fairly comprehensive
evaluation checklist.
Ford and General Motors, for example, have 172
products the car manufacturers say
specialists
should finish before validating a secondhand Ford, Buick, GMC, or Chevrolet
car as CPO. If you're not
particularly mechanically likely, the
relative comfort purchasing CPO
can provide might be well worth it. <BR>

picture-in-picture" allowfullscreen></iframe><BR> 4. CPO
Automobiles Still Have a Lot of
Life in Them. <BR> To qualify as CPO, a vehicle generally
should meet age and mileage
constraints. This, too,
differs by manufacturer, but
normally CPO
automobiles and trucks are not
more than five to six years of ages and have
less than 75,000 miles on them. A lot of manufacturers will include benefits such as 24-hour roadside
service and SiriusXM radio with a CPO purchase. <BR> 5. You Get
Less Variety, But CPOs You'll Find
Are Choice. <BR> If you're trying to find a Porsche 911 with a manual transmission and
a couple of specific
alternatives-- as we
frequently aimlessly discover ourselves
doing-- looking for out one that is
offered as a CPO is most likely
simply this side of difficult. Even when
looking for something more
common, amongst utilized
automobiles on a
dealership lot, the huge bulk aren't CPO.
One car dealership in Ann Arbor, Michigan,
for instance, has 1507
used vehicles
listed for sale on its site, only 63 of
which are CPO. The smaller numbers are
discussed-- and warranted-- by
the number of criteria we've simply described that CPO
vehicles need to
fulfill. Some car manufacturers
give shoppers a period, such as three days or 150 miles,
to test out a CPO and decide whether
they 'd rather swap it out for something else.<BR><BR>
